Read the excerpt below carefully:

"The silver moon was a glowing lantern in the dark,
Guiding the lost travelers through the woods."

Which literary device is used in the line "The silver moon was a glowing lantern in the dark"?

Answer

Metaphor
Metaphor is correct because the line directly states that the moon was a glowing lantern without using comparative words such as 'like' or 'as'.

Step-by-Step Solution

1
Analyze the targeted line from the excerpt
The phrase compares 'the silver moon' directly to 'a glowing lantern'.
Identifying the two subjects being linked in the poetic imagery.
2
Determine the mode of comparison
The comparison is direct and asserts identity without using 'like' or 'as'.
A direct comparison asserting that one object is another defines a metaphor.
